State Police Report No Fatal Crashes During Traffic Safety Initiative

(Richmond)- Virginia State Police say there were no fatal crashes during the “I-95 Drive to Save Lives” initiative. The annual traffic enforcement initiative was held earlier this month in 15 states from Florida to Maine. Police reported 194 citations were issued for speeding and eleven were given for drivers not wearing a seatbelt. They also cited 20 drivers for cellphone use. All money from these tickets will go toward court fees and the state’s literary fund.
